PG&E negotiates price cuts on five solar, battery contracts
PG&E Corp on Thursday told a U.S. bankruptcy judge that it had reached agreements to cut prices by at least 10% on five power contracts, according to court papers.
GoPro lifts revenue forecast on new product slate, shares rebound
GoPro Inc raised its 2019 revenue forecast on Thursday, as the action camera maker bets on new releases slated for later this year and helping shares reverse course to trade up 5%.
Pinterest beats revenue on user addition, lifts 2019 sales forecast
Pinterest Inc raised its full-year sales forecast and reported second-quarter revenue above Wall Street estimates on Thursday, as the online scrapbook company added more users, sending its shares up 12% in extended trading.
Pentagon puts $10 billion JEDI contract on hold after Trump suggests it favored Amazon
The Pentagon has decided to put on hold its decision to award a $10 billion cloud computing contract after President Donald Trump said his administration was examining Amazon.com Inc’s bid following complaints from other tech companies.

Trump vows new tariffs on China, says Xi moving too slow on trade
President Donald Trump said on Thursday he would impose a 10% tariff on the remaining $300 billion of Chinese imports starting Sept. 1, after negotiators failed to make progress in U.S.-China trade talks, sending shockwaves through U.S. markets.
Bayer sees potential future business in plant-based meat market
A Bayer executive on Thursday said the company was closely watching the plant-based meat market which has seen booming demand in recent years, adding that Bayer could potentially enter the market as an alternative protein source provider.
